We study the density X(t,x)X(t,x) of one-dimensional super-Brownian motion and find the asymptotic behaviour of (...) as well as the Hausdorff dimension of the boundary of the support of X(t,⋅)X(t,⋅). The answers are in terms of the leading eigenvalue of the Ornstein–Uhlenbeck generator with a particular killing term. This work is motivated in part by questions of pathwise uniqueness for associated stochastic partial differential equations.
